Last Updated at 11 October 2024PS Naugawan: A Rural Primary School in Uttar Pradesh
PS Naugawan, a primary school nestled in the rural landscape of Sultanpur district, Uttar Pradesh, stands as a testament to the dedication to education in even the most remote areas. Established in 1963, this government-managed school plays a vital role in the community, providing essential primary education to children from Class 1 to Class 5.
A Co-educational Learning Environment:
The school embraces a co-educational environment, fostering inclusivity and providing equal opportunities for both boys and girls. With a total of two teachers – one male and one female – the school offers personalized attention to its students. Hindi serves as the primary medium of instruction. The school operates within a government-provided building, encompassing three well-maintained classrooms. Beyond the classrooms, additional space is allocated for non-teaching activities and a dedicated room for the head teacher, Rana Pratap Singh.
Facilities and Resources:
While lacking electricity and a boundary wall, the school boasts essential amenities. A functional library houses 100 books, enriching the learning experience. A playground provides a space for recreation and physical activity, contributing to the holistic development of students. Hand pumps provide a reliable source of drinking water, addressing a crucial need for hygiene and health. Ramps for disabled children ensure accessibility to classrooms, reflecting a commitment to inclusivity. The school also provides mid-day meals, prepared on-site, ensuring that students receive proper nourishment.
Academic Focus and Management:
PS Naugawan focuses solely on primary education (Classes 1-5). Although the school does not offer a pre-primary section, it strives to equip its students with a strong foundation in basic education. The school falls under the Department of Education, benefiting from government support and resources. The school operates on an academic calendar starting in April.
